P. cubensis are tropical fungus. winter is cool and dry, summer is hot and dry and wet. usually its humid and hot. so when clouds come roaring in the temps (and air pressure, probably not a trigger) go down and humidity moisture go up. because it has been so hot during the summer, and there is some moisture the mycelium will often grow a bit, when the temps drop and the humidity and moisture are high they will fruit (mushrooms). this allows them to fruit and spread their seeds without drying up in the otherwise hot sun. not always but usually. for the record this specie will grow on seemingly any organics containing cellulose and plant material. grass clippings/straw, grains, paper you name it. may not fruit, but the mycelium is very aggressive. i have used it to study composting a bit (not as great as others do to easily being overtaken by other mycelium).

But Freeztar, in the PNW (i am from there as well) the "magic mushrooms" there are much different. some grow in grass, especially old cow fields, some grow right from decaying wood (Seattle is famous for this), others form relationships with roots of trees. there are lots of "magic" mushroom species. In the PNW most of our mushrooms seem to like fall/winter/spring, usually before and after the snow, but not always. Things like our "magic mushroom" species, edibles like chantrelles, lobster (and the Russule sp. they take over) etc. others like oyster mushrooms fruit all year round, weather permitting. every specie is different but many mushrooms fruit with a humidity/moisture trigger and a temperature trigger.

When i had my nursery we used to sell an African bulb we called Storm Lilly". It is a pretty little white crocus bulby thing. It always flowered well after storms and we sold heaps of it- otherwise not and it just looked like boring grass. I knew Brugmansias would flower 6-8 weeks after a heavy watering (Always gave nine a good drink mid-Novemeber so they would be flowering for family and visitors at Christmas)so I tried the same trick with the crocus. Got to the stage finally of immersing the pots overnight in water. No flowers no matter how hard I tried.
A storm with lightening, BINGO out popped the flowers.
HOW do they know?

The nonpartisan New Zealand Drug Foundation (NZDF) is attempting to jump-start a renewed national debate about marijuana policy in the country, and it appears to be working. Since its call for a "national conversation" a week ago, NZDF has garnered considerable media attention and prompted responses from activist groups, political parties, and government officials.

http://stopthedrugwar.org/files/talkaboutpot.jpg
c
"Cannabis is New Zealand's favorite illicit drug," said NZDF executive director Ross Bell as he kicked off the crusade, "but it receives scant attention from politicians, policymakers or the media. When it is discussed, evidence is often discarded in favor of myth, misinformation and polarized posturing."
